Git是一种版本控制工具,它可以帮助开发人员管理代码的版本。Git的使用可以分为以下几个步骤:,,1. 安装Git,2. 配置用户信息,3. 学习Git基本命令,4. 学习Git分支管理
本文目录导读:
在软件开发领域,版本控制是一个至关重要的概念,它可以帮助团队成员跟踪代码的变更历史,协同工作,以及回滚到之前的某个版本,本文将重点介绍一个非常流行的版本控制系统——Git,我们将从Git的基本概念、安装和配置、常用命令等方面进行详细讲解,帮助大家更好地理解和掌握Git的使用。
Git基本概念
1、什么是Git?
Git是一个分布式版本控制系统,用于跟踪文件的更改和协调多个开发者之间的工作,它起源于Linus Torvalds为Linux内核开发的版本控制系统,后来发展成为了一个独立的项目,并被广泛应用于各种软件开发场景。
2、Git的优点
- 分布式:Git可以在本地仓库的基础上扩展到整个网络,实现多人协作开发。
- 速度快:Git的提交和推送操作速度非常快,可以大大提高开发效率。
- 数据安全:Git使用SHA-1哈希算法对数据进行签名,确保数据的完整性和安全性。
- 历史记录:Git可以记录每个版本的详细信息,方便开发者回溯和分析历史。
安装和配置
1、下载安装Git
访问Git官网(https://git-scm.com/)下载适合你操作系统的安装包,然后按照提示进行安装。
2、配置用户名和邮箱
在安装完成后,打开命令行工具,输入以下命令进行配置:
git config --global user.name "你的用户名" git config --global user.email "你的邮箱"
常用命令
1、初始化仓库
在项目根目录下执行以下命令,创建一个新的Git仓库:
git init
2、添加文件到暂存区
将需要提交的文件添加到暂存区,可以使用以下命令:
git add 文件名
或者添加所有文件:
git add .
3、提交更改
将暂存区的文件提交到本地仓库,并附上一条描述信息:
git commit -m "提交信息"
4、查看状态和日志
查看当前仓库的状态和提交历史:
git status git log --oneline --decorate --graph --all
5、克隆远程仓库
从远程仓库克隆代码到本地:
git clone 远程仓库地址
或者拉取远程仓库的更新:
git pull 远程仓库名 分支名
6、推送代码到远程仓库(通常与拉取操作配合使用)
将本地仓库的代码推送到远程仓库:
git push origin 分支名 ```或者推送所有分支:
git push origin --all
```同时也可以指定远程仓库的名字:
git push other_remote_name branch_name ```其中other_remote_name是远程仓库的名字,branch_name是要推送的分支名。